    Abstract: A computational instance may includes a set of computing devices and a configuration management database (CMDB), wherein the CMDB contains a representation of a service deployed on a managed network, wherein the representation of the service includes metadata, service group membership, and an entry point, and wherein the computational instance is configured to: receive an instruction to export the representation of the service to a file; copy, to a metadata object in the file, the metadata; determine a hierarchical subset of the service groups that are related to the service; write, to one or more service group objects in the file, the hierarchical subset of the service groups; determine, from a list of entry points of the managed network, that the entry point is of the service; and write, to an entry point object in the file, the entry point.

    Abstract: Systems, methods, and media for tracking configuration file changes are presented. Tracking configuration file changes include receiving a definition of a pattern used to identify a configuration file to be tracked. Horizontal discovery is performed using the pattern to discover the configuration file based at least in part on the pattern. If an entry in a configuration management database corresponds to a previously discovered configuration file has not been discovered during the horizontal discovery, the entry is deleted from the configuration management database. With discovered configuration files, the configuration management database is updated with the discovered configuration file as a configuration item. Using the configuration management database changes to the configuration file are tracked and displayed in a timeline and history of the discovered configuration file.

    Abstract: Persistent storage may contain a list of discovery commands, the discovery commands respectively associated with lists of network addresses. A discovery validation application, when executed by one or more processors, may be configured to: read, from the persistent storage, the list of discovery commands and the lists of network addresses; for each discovery command in the list of discovery commands, transmit, by way of one or more proxy servers deployed external to the system, the discovery command to each network address in the respectively associated list of network addresses; receive, by way of the one or more proxy servers, discovery results respectively corresponding to each of the discovery commands that were transmitted, wherein the discovery results either indicate success or failure of the discovery commands; and write, to the persistent storage, the discovery results.

    Abstract: Systems, methods, and media are presented that are used to recompute a service model to match data in a configuration management database. Recomputing includes detecting a change to a configuration item in a configuration management database and marking a recomputing environment indicating a recomputing environment to be recomputed based on the change. Using a recomputation job, a service environment database is queried and a response is received from the service environment indicating at least the recomputing environment. The recomputation job then recomputes the service environment to match a service model to the change in the configuration management database.

    Abstract: A first type of service map may be converted to a second type of a service map by adding a conversion tag to a set of configuration items (CIs) presented by the service map. The conversion tag includes data that may be used to link historical information associated with the service map of the first type, such as information related to incidents, alerts, change requests, and other events, to the second type. A second service map may be generated using the conversion tags and/or tag-based filtering processes such that the second service map displays different CIs as compared to the first service map.

    Abstract: Systems, methods, and media for utilizing a discovery pattern affinity table are disclosed herein. The pattern affinity table includes one or more discovery patterns and associated data. The pattern affinity table is updated upon execution of a new or existing discovery pattern to reflect near real-time data associated with the discovery patterns. The pattern affinity table reduces an amount of time and computing resources needed to perform a discovery process by executing the discovery patterns stored in the affinity table.

    Abstract: A computational instance of a remote network management platform includes a database that contains a plurality of CI records corresponding to a set of computing devices, a set of software applications, and a network-based service. The database also contains a definition of a service model that represents the set of computing devices, the set of software applications, and relationships therebetween that facilitate providing the network-based service. The computational instance also includes one or more server devices configured: to receive an indication of a change to a CI record of the plurality of CI record; add, to a change record table, a change record corresponding to the change to the CI record; select, for the service layer based on a change type specified in the change record, a service model re-computation mode; and re-compute a service layer in accordance with the service model re-computation mode.
